Police: Elderly couple robbed at knifepoint in Springetts
Springettsbury Township Police are asking for the public's help to identify a knife-wielding man who robbed an elderly couple Monday in a supermarket parking lot.
Police said the victims — both in their 70s — were in the lot of Weis Markets, 2400 E. Market St., about 7:40 p.m. when they were approached by a man displaying a knife.
He robbed them of a wallet and a purse, then fled in a gray or blue sedan, possibly a Nissan, according to police. The car was last seen headed east on East Market Street, police said.
The robber is described as white, stocky, about 6 feet tall, with dark hair and a short-trimmed beard. He was wearing a dark, hooded sweatshirt and baggy pants.
Anyone with information about the robbery or the robber's identity is asked to call police at (717) 757-3525.
